Horror movies feature heavy gradients—light fading into pitch-black darkness, beams of flashlights cutting through dense fog, and smoky apparitions. In an 8-bit file, these gradients often look like blocky "bands" of color. The 10-bit depth smoothens these transitions perfectly. For a week, nothing happened
